  • by Bára Anna Stejskalová

    A candid discussion between a director and a producer on the challenges and triumphs of creating a stop-motion musical. Featuring acclaimed director Bára Anna Stejskalová (Love Is Just a Death Away, 9 Million Colors) and Emmy Award-winning producer Jakub Košťál (Bionaut Animation, CZ), the session will dive into the intricacies of the genre, touching on topics like working with directors of photography, navigating budgets, overcoming production setbacks, and handling very tricky puppets. It’s an honest talk about the highs and lows of stop-motion filmmaking.

  • 4:3

    2019 16+ 5 min

    by Ross Hogg

    Separate projections combine, unifying, becoming whole. Twelve animated projections combine to develop a rhythmic dialogue exploring the intrinsic relationship between sound and image using 16mm film, paint and a projector. Responding to a hand-drawn soundtrack, each projection is individually created by painting and scratching directly on 16mm film stock.

  • by Philip Scott Johnson

    This animation was created in April 2007 using a program called Abrosoft Fantamorph. The cost at the time was 30 US dollars. My thought at the time was rather than creating simple humorous morphs, that were common at the time, why not instead create an artistic film that loops multiple animations together and tells the story of art over time.

  • by Various directors

    The Global Animation Community unites in solidarity with Gaza to form AC4PAL. AC4Pal was created to support the work of Haneen Koraz, an animator based in Gaza who has been running animation workshops with displaced children and women across the region. The project “To Gaza with Love: A Global Anijam” brings together 329 short films from over 50 countries, created by animators, students, and studios in a collective act of solidarity with the people of Gaza.

  • 2 Hours! FULL Series 1 Creature Comforts

    2003 All audiences 113 min

    by Richard Starzak

    Stop-motion animated satire of modern man on the street and documentary interviews, responding to unseen questioners. The voices of the characters are supplied by everyday people speaking varied regional accents.
